Texas SB1994 amends Water Code to require law enforcement, fire protection, and emergency services plans for certain conservation and reclamation.
Texas SB1994 amends the Texas Water Code to modify the requirements for petitions to create water control and improvement districts, freshwater supply districts, or municipal utility districts. The bill mandates that petitions for these districts, filed on or after the effective date of the Act, must include plans for law enforcement, fire protection, and emergency services, as well as roads that allow fire trucks to turn around.
